WebJul 16, 2024 · Texas rarely comes to mind, but the truth is that the second-largest state in the US receives its fair share of storms, temperature extremes, and drought. And in a state that is already known for high temperatures and desert-like conditions, drought is a weather phenomenon that makes landscaping and gardening in Texas a challenge at times. WebSep 7, 2024 · 4 Best Flowering Shrubs for North and North-Central Texas Region. Most of North and North-Central Texas gets characterized by grasslands and prairies with periods of drought and intense summer temperatures, so plants that thrive here are typically drought-tolerant. Coralberry WebFor the last fifteen years shrub roses have played a large role in Texas landscaping but with Rose Rosette disease these plantings have been wiped out. Dwarf and miniature crape myrtles are a good substitute for the loss of color associated with the lose of roses from Rose Rosette disease. WebSep 30, 2024 · Japanese Holly (Ilex crenata) The Spruce / David Beaulieu. Japanese holly looks more like a boxwood shrub than a holly shrub, bearing small, oval leaves. Many cultivars of this broadleaf evergreen are available. For hedge plants, most people select those that reach 3 to 4 feet in height with a similar spread. It can also be very challenging to find flowering perennials that will bloom in the shade. Turk’s Cap ( Malvaviscus arboreus) is the rare unicorn of a plant that will bloom profusely. This native Texas shade perennial is covered in bright red blooms from late spring through fall.

WebCarolina Cherry (Prunus caroliniana 'Compacta'): This Texas native is one of the best hedges you can find for Houston landscapes. It features dense, dark green foliage and a near perfect shape with little maintenance required. Also, while the foliage is beautiful, it also has a pleasing scent.
